摘要

This paper reports inclusive and differential measurements of the tt¯ charge asymmetry AC in 20.3 fb-1 of s=8TeV pp collisions recorded by the ATLAS experiment at the Large Hadron Collider at CERN. Three differential measurements are performed as a function of the invariant mass, transverse momentum and longitudinal boost of the tt¯ system. The tt¯ pairs are selected in the single-lepton channels (e or μ) with at least four jets, and a likelihood fit is used to reconstruct the tt¯ event kinematics. A Bayesian unfolding procedure is performed to infer the asymmetry at parton level from the observed data distribution. The inclusive tt¯ charge asymmetry is measured to be AC = 0.009 ± 0.005 (stat. +  syst.). The inclusive and differential measurements are compatible with the values predicted by the Standard Model.
